Unlocking ferroelectricity in a metal-free adamantane derivative via targeted symmetry reduction

resumo

By introducing a symmetry-reduction design strategy in adamantane derivatives, overcoming the inherent high symmetry of globular molecules that typically hinders long-range electrical ordering, we report a metal-free ferroelectric 2-adamantylammonium bromide (2-ADAB) with a high Curie temperature of 383 K and robust polarization switching.
